Schedule Options:
Five 8-hour shifts, four 10-hour shifts, or three 12-hour shifts per week (all starting at 6:00am)On-call:
48 hours required per 6-week period, including one weekend per monthKey Qualifications:
Active RN licensure in Michigan BLS certification required Strong recent experience in OR, with advanced cardiac scrub skills Capacity to collaborate within a multidisciplinary team Exceptional organizational skills and flexibility with schedulingPrimary Responsibilities:
Lead the delivery of compassionate, high-quality patient care Utilize the nursing process for assessment, planning, implementation, evaluation, documentation, and patient/family education Delegate activities and supervise team members in the clinical setting Communicate effectively with healthcare professionals and families regarding patient status and needs Respond proactively to care variances, collaborate on solutions, and ensure positive patient outcomesExceptional Benefits and Perks:
